Author: eric
Date: Wed Apr 6 15:35:34 2011
New Revision: 1089496
URL: http://svn.apache.org/viewvc?rev=1089496&view=rev
Log:
Rename spring bean definition from virtualusertable to recipientrewritetable
(JAMES-1218)
Modified:
james/server/trunk/container-spring/src/main/config/james/context/james-server-context.xml
james/server/trunk/data-library/src/main/java/org/apache/james/rrt/lib/RecipientRewriteTableManagement.java
james/server/trunk/mailets/src/main/java/org/apache/james/transport/mailets/VirtualUserTable.java
james/server/trunk/mailets/src/test/java/org/apache/james/transport/mailets/RecipientRewriteTableTest.java
james/server/trunk/smtpserver/src/main/java/org/apache/james/smtpserver/fastfail/ValidRcptHandler.java
james/server/trunk/smtpserver/src/test/java/org/apache/james/smtpserver/SMTPServerTest.java
Modified:
james/server/trunk/container-spring/src/main/config/james/context/james-server-context.xml
URL:
http://svn.apache.org/viewvc/james/server/trunk/container-spring/src/main/config/james/context/james-server-context.xml?rev=1089496&r1=1089495&r2=1089496&view=diff
==============================================================================
---
james/server/trunk/container-spring/src/main/config/james/context/james-server-context.xml
(original)
+++
james/server/trunk/container-spring/src/main/config/james/context/james-server-context.xml
Wed Apr 6 15:35:34 2011
@@ -65,10 +65,10 @@
<!-- no alias needed -->
<value></value>
</entry>
- <!-- Virtual User Table-->
+ <!-- Recipient Rewrite Table-->
<entry>
<key>
- <value>virtualusertable</value>
+ <value>recipientrewritetable</value>
</key>
<!-- no alias needed -->
<value></value>
@@ -378,7 +378,7 @@
<entry key="org.apache.james:type=server,name=imapserver"
value-ref="imapserver"/>
<entry key="org.apache.james:type=component,name=domainlist"
value-ref="domainlistmanagement"/>
<entry key="org.apache.james:type=component,name=dnsservice"
value-ref="dnsservice"/>
- <entry key="org.apache.james:type=component,name=virtualusertable"
value-ref="virtualusertablemanagement"/>
+ <entry
key="org.apache.james:type=component,name=recipientrewritetable"
value-ref="recipientrewritetablemanagement"/>
<entry key="org.apache.james:type=component,name=usersrepository"
value-ref="usersrepositorymanagement"/>
<entry key="org.apache.james:type=component,name=fetchmail"
value-ref="fetchmail"/>
<entry key="org.apache.james:type=component,name=mailboxmanagement"
value-ref="mailboxmanagermanagement"/>
@@ -390,12 +390,12 @@
</property>
<property name="assembler">
<bean
class="org.springframework.jmx.export.assembler.InterfaceBasedMBeanInfoAssembler">
- <property name="managedInterfaces"
value="org.apache.james.smtpserver.netty.SMTPServerMBean,org.apache.james.pop3server.netty.POP3ServerMBean,org.apache.james.imapserver.netty.IMAPServerMBean,org.apache.james.fetchmail.FetchSchedulerMBean,org.apache.james.domainlist.api.DomainListManagementMBean,org.apache.james.dnsservice.api.DNSServiceMBean,org.apache.james.vut.api.VirtualUserTableManagementMBean,org.apache.james.user.api.UsersRepositoryManagementMBean,org.apache.james.adapter.mailbox.MailboxManagerManagementMBean,org.apache.james.container.spring.mailbox.MailboxCopierManagementMBean,org.apache.james.mailetcontainer.api.jmx.MailSpoolerMBean,org.apache.james.container.spring.provider.log.LogProviderManagementMBean"/>
+ <property name="managedInterfaces"
value="org.apache.james.smtpserver.netty.SMTPServerMBean,org.apache.james.pop3server.netty.POP3ServerMBean,org.apache.james.imapserver.netty.IMAPServerMBean,org.apache.james.fetchmail.FetchSchedulerMBean,org.apache.james.domainlist.api.DomainListManagementMBean,org.apache.james.dnsservice.api.DNSServiceMBean,org.apache.james.rrt.api.RecipientRewriteTableManagementMBean,org.apache.james.user.api.UsersRepositoryManagementMBean,org.apache.james.adapter.mailbox.MailboxManagerManagementMBean,org.apache.james.container.spring.mailbox.MailboxCopierManagementMBean,org.apache.james.mailetcontainer.api.jmx.MailSpoolerMBean,org.apache.james.container.spring.provider.log.LogProviderManagementMBean"/>
</bean>
</property>
</bean>
<bean id="usersrepositorymanagement"
class="org.apache.james.user.lib.UsersRepositoryManagement" />
- <bean id="virtualusertablemanagement"
class="org.apache.james.vut.lib.VirtualUserTableManagement" />
+ <bean id="recipientrewritetablemanagement"
class="org.apache.james.rrt.lib.RecipientRewriteTableManagement" />
<bean id="domainlistmanagement"
class="org.apache.james.domainlist.lib.DomainListManagement" />
<bean id="mailboxmanagermanagement"
class="org.apache.james.adapter.mailbox.MailboxManagerManagement" />
<bean id="mailboxcopiermanagement"
class="org.apache.james.container.spring.mailbox.MailboxCopierManagement" />
Modified:
james/server/trunk/data-library/src/main/java/org/apache/james/rrt/lib/RecipientRewriteTableManagement.java
URL:
http://svn.apache.org/viewvc/james/server/trunk/data-library/src/main/java/org/apache/james/rrt/lib/RecipientRewriteTableManagement.java?rev=1089496&r1=1089495&r2=1089496&view=diff
==============================================================================
---
james/server/trunk/data-library/src/main/java/org/apache/james/rrt/lib/RecipientRewriteTableManagement.java
(original)
+++
james/server/trunk/data-library/src/main/java/org/apache/james/rrt/lib/RecipientRewriteTableManagement.java
Wed Apr 6 15:35:34 2011
@@ -41,7 +41,7 @@ public class RecipientRewriteTableManage
private RecipientRewriteTable vut;
- @Resource(name = "virtualusertable")
+ @Resource(name = "recipientrewritetable")
public void setManageableVirtualUserTable(RecipientRewriteTable vut) {
this.vut = vut;
}
Modified:
james/server/trunk/mailets/src/main/java/org/apache/james/transport/mailets/VirtualUserTable.java
URL:
http://svn.apache.org/viewvc/james/server/trunk/mailets/src/main/java/org/apache/james/transport/mailets/VirtualUserTable.java?rev=1089496&r1=1089495&r2=1089496&view=diff
==============================================================================
---
james/server/trunk/mailets/src/main/java/org/apache/james/transport/mailets/VirtualUserTable.java
(original)
+++
james/server/trunk/mailets/src/main/java/org/apache/james/transport/mailets/VirtualUserTable.java
Wed Apr 6 15:35:34 2011
@@ -43,7 +43,7 @@ public class VirtualUserTable extends Ab
* @param vutStore
* the vutStore to set, possibly null
*/
- @Resource(name = "virtualusertable")
+ @Resource(name = "recipientrewritetable")
public final void
setVirtualUserTable(org.apache.james.rrt.api.RecipientRewriteTable vut) {
this.vut = vut;
}
Modified:
james/server/trunk/mailets/src/test/java/org/apache/james/transport/mailets/RecipientRewriteTableTest.java
URL:
http://svn.apache.org/viewvc/james/server/trunk/mailets/src/test/java/org/apache/james/transport/mailets/RecipientRewriteTableTest.java?rev=1089496&r1=1089495&r2=1089496&view=diff
==============================================================================
---
james/server/trunk/mailets/src/test/java/org/apache/james/transport/mailets/RecipientRewriteTableTest.java
(original)
+++
james/server/trunk/mailets/src/test/java/org/apache/james/transport/mailets/RecipientRewriteTableTest.java
Wed Apr 6 15:35:34 2011
@@ -59,7 +59,7 @@ public class RecipientRewriteTableTest e
};
FakeMailetConfig mockMailetConfig = new FakeMailetConfig("vut",
mockMailetContext, new Properties());
- // mockMailetConfig.put("virtualusertable", "vut");
+ // mockMailetConfig.put("recipientrewritetable", "vut");
table.setVirtualUserTable(new
org.apache.james.rrt.api.RecipientRewriteTable() {
public Collection<String> getMappings(String user, String domain)
throws ErrorMappingException, RecipientRewriteTableException {
Modified:
james/server/trunk/smtpserver/src/main/java/org/apache/james/smtpserver/fastfail/ValidRcptHandler.java
URL:
http://svn.apache.org/viewvc/james/server/trunk/smtpserver/src/main/java/org/apache/james/smtpserver/fastfail/ValidRcptHandler.java?rev=1089496&r1=1089495&r2=1089496&view=diff
==============================================================================
---
james/server/trunk/smtpserver/src/main/java/org/apache/james/smtpserver/fastfail/ValidRcptHandler.java
(original)
+++
james/server/trunk/smtpserver/src/main/java/org/apache/james/smtpserver/fastfail/ValidRcptHandler.java
Wed Apr 6 15:35:34 2011
@@ -76,7 +76,7 @@ public class ValidRcptHandler extends Ab
* @param tableStore
* the tableStore to set
*/
- @Resource(name = "virtualusertable")
+ @Resource(name = "recipientrewritetable")
public final void setVirtualUserTable(RecipientRewriteTable vut) {
this.vut = vut;
}
Modified:
james/server/trunk/smtpserver/src/test/java/org/apache/james/smtpserver/SMTPServerTest.java
URL:
http://svn.apache.org/viewvc/james/server/trunk/smtpserver/src/test/java/org/apache/james/smtpserver/SMTPServerTest.java?rev=1089496&r1=1089495&r2=1089496&view=diff
==============================================================================
---
james/server/trunk/smtpserver/src/test/java/org/apache/james/smtpserver/SMTPServerTest.java
(original)
+++
james/server/trunk/smtpserver/src/test/java/org/apache/james/smtpserver/SMTPServerTest.java
Wed Apr 6 15:35:34 2011
@@ -300,7 +300,7 @@ public abstract class SMTPServerTest ext
m_serviceManager.put("filesystem", fileSystem);
m_serviceManager.put("org.apache.james.smtpserver.protocol.DNSService",
dnsAdapter);
- m_serviceManager.put("virtualusertable", new RecipientRewriteTable() {
+ m_serviceManager.put("recipientrewritetable", new
RecipientRewriteTable() {
public void addRegexMapping(String user, String domain, String
regex) throws RecipientRewriteTableException {
throw new UnsupportedOperationException("Not implemented");
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]